Why I don’t walk to school

The other day, some poor soul had to lift and carry my backpack. I watched her face contort into a pained cringe and I knew then that I had given her a cruel, cruel task.

“What do you have in here?” she asked. “Oh, books and my laptop” I replied. It didn’t sound like that much, but my backpack is pretty darn heavy.

Here’s what’s in my backpack today.

- laptop (IBM Thinkpad) 4.8 lbs
- Macro book (about 2 lbs)
- pencil bag (pens, white-board markers, HP 10BII calculator) 1 lb
- Strategy coursepack (about 2 lbs)
- umbrella .5 lbs
- gym clothes in a snazzy QFC bag (1 lb)
- water bottle (1.5 lbs)
- binder 4 lbs
- phone .75 lbs (it’s big)
- laptop case 1 lbs
- laptop cable 1 lb
- padlock .5 lbs
- other random crap .5 lbs

Total 20.5 lbs
